The papers focus on late Cenozoic mammals in North America and Africa, and provide site-specific descriptions of faunas and their associated geological contexts, plus more general syntheses of regional palaeoenvironments and biogeography. The volume contains individual discussions of North American fossil prairie dogs, mastodons, zebras, short-faced bears, sabre cats, lions, giant armadillos, elk-moose, caribou and muskrats, as well as African hyaenas, zebras, hipparion horses, antelopes, rodents and giraffes.
